Control system upgrade for the BEPCII upgrade project
摘要
This paper describes the design and implementation of the control system for the BEPCII upgrade project, which was undertaken to meet the enhanced performance requirements of the accelerator complex.
MethodsBased on the EPICS framework, the original control system—which had been operating reliably since 2005 but was considered obsolete in both hardware and software—was completely redesigned and rebuilt to support higher colliding beam currents, increased RF cavity voltages, and improved data acquisition efficiency.
ResultsThe new control system was completed and commissioned in November 2024 and is currently operating normally. It successfully supports the BEPCII upgrade goal of tripling the peak luminosity in the high-energy region.
ConclusionThe EPICS-based control system redesign effectively addresses the obsolescence of the original system and fulfills the new operational requirements, providing a reliable foundation for the upgraded performance of BEPCII.
